The Loup
Coordinates: 54°42′00″N 6°35′53″W / 54.700°N 6.598°W Loup or the Loup (from Irish: an Lúb)[1] is a small village in County Londonderry, Northern Ireland. It lies near the western shore of Lough Neagh between Moneymore, Magherafelt, Ballyronan and Coagh. It is situated within Mid-Ulster District.
Sport
Gaelic games are very popular in the area, with An Lúb CLG being the local club.[2]
